We advise every author to follow the ethical guidelines while preparing the full length papers for submission at ICNEET 2025. Please check the following before submitting your full length paper: 

  • Submit the full length papers to "icneet@gpcet.ac.in"
  • All the references listed in the reference list should be cited inside the text and only papers which are directly related to the manuscript should only be included as references.
  • All the figures and tables should be of high quality/definition.
  • References which are not relevant to the paper should not be included. Breaching this will result in the paper being excluded from the submission to the publisher for publication.  
  • Authors should be more cautious while including their own papers in the reference list (self-citation). References which are not related to the paper and also systematic inclusion of self-citations will result in the paper being excluded from the submission. 
  • If two or more papers by the same author have been accepted, the corresponding author should make sure that there is no significant overlap in the papers with respect to the content and also concept.  
  • Reference list should perfectly follow the unique template of referencing such as author names, title of the paper, journal/conference name, pagination, volume/issue number and year of publication. Do not include the DoI in the reference list. 
  • No author name shall be included or replaced in the final version of the paper. Author names and order in the Camera Ready Paper / revised paper should be same as the initially submitted paper.  
  • Important note – Manipulations in the manuscript in any form such as intentionally including citations, similarity and AI/ChatGPT written content can’t be accepted. Papers involving in any of the above cases will be removed from the proceedings and will not be submitted to the publisher for publication. The conference has full rights to remove such papers at any stage from initial screening to final submission to the publisher (if found in the later stage after conference and before publication). In such cases, registration fees will not be refunded.

All papers must be structured as per the official ICNEET-2025 template. The manuscript should not exceed 6 pages, inclusive of all visuals, tables, and references. Each paper should consist of the following sections: Title, Abstract, Keywords, Introduction, Methodology, Results, Discussion, Conclusion, Acknowledgments (if applicable), and References.

Authors are expected to clearly articulate how their work contributes to the overarching themes of advanced material science and sustainable engineering. Submissions will be evaluated based on scientific rigor, innovation, and applicability to practical challenges in engineering.

All submissions will undergo a rigorous plagiarism check:

  • ≤ 15% Similarity: Accepted for peer review.
  • 16–30% Similarity: Returned to authors for necessary revisions.
  • 30% Similarity: Rejected without further consideration. Proper citation and referencing of all sources are mandatory to uphold ethical publication standards.

The technical program committee follows the stringent peer-review process which ensues both the technical quality and COPE guidelines. All the submitted manuscripts will be sent for peer review and the corresponding author will be notified the outcome of the review process. If reviewers recommended for further improvements in the manuscript, the manuscript will be sent back to the corresponding author and the revised version of the manuscript shall be submitted within fifteen days on the date of notification. Blind Review Policy

  • We are committed to timely evaluation and presentation/publication of fully approved papers at the ICNEET 2025. All submissions are subjected to a rigorous review procedure in order to maintain a high-quality publication. The following are the characteristics of the blind peer-review procedure:

  • Parallel submissions of the same Research Paper to a different Conference, Journals or Symposium will not be accepted.

  • Papers having content outside the scope will not be reviewed.

  • In accordance with ICNEET 2025 policy, submissions will be assessed by 3 experts as suggested by the organizing committee.

  • Presentation and publication related decision(s) are made by the Organizing Committee (ICNEET), based on the reports given by the experts. The authors of papers that are not approved will be notified promptly and the decision taken by the organizing committee ICNEET will be the final verdict.

  • All the submitted papers are considered confidential documents. We expect our Board of Reviewing Editors and reviewers to treat the papers as confidential matters as well.

  • Editors and Reviewers must ensure the papers meet all the mentioned requirements.

  • Editors and reviewers engaged in the review procedure must state any conflict of interest arising from direct competition, collaboration, or other ties with any of the authors, and should withdraw themselves from situations where such conflicts prevent objective evaluation. The utilization of privileged information or ideas received via peer review for competitive benefit is prohibited.

  • Review reports should be made available on request to the Managing Editor if required.

  • The identities of the reviewers cannot be disclosed, and the peer review procedure is confidential.
